Transaction 58a2d8ea8c862c8e82a6e19bfafe33955e51e4a38b6d92228a43cee52121ac70

1 Input
2 Outputs
  • 58a2d8ea8c862c8e82a6e19bfafe33955e51e4a38b6d92228a43cee52121ac70:0
  • value  17005397
    address  33FV5qUkGKGpuWWxUPXuHhjtgzsWChSrkP
  • 58a2d8ea8c862c8e82a6e19bfafe33955e51e4a38b6d92228a43cee52121ac70:1
  • value  6786000
    address  3CttfUWjJWLqTgv6FzNC55ttw1xzTnkeYa